The former residence of the erstwhile royal family, this grand palace was commissioned by Sayajirao Gaekwad III in 1890, and designed by British architects Major Charles Mant and RF Chisolm. Tickets include a free audio guide—essential to get a historical background of the palace’s rich architectural and artistic heritage. Designed in the Indo-Saracenic style, Laxmi Vilas blends Hindu, Islamic and European elements. The highlights include the grand Durbar Hall, which has a Venetian mosaic floor, Belgian stained glass windows and Italian sculptures, and an art museum. Dotted with sculptures, the palace’s sprawling grounds are home to the Gaekwad Baroda Golf Club and a miniature railway line. There’s also a pretty baoli or step-well, located at a distance of 50 metres from the palace.
